A
Asli Durmus Review of The Hippodrome Istanbul
The heart of Istanbul ... Hippodrome, then Horse s...
The heart of Istanbul ... Hippodrome, then Horse square. Traces of the Latin invasion are still visible, this is the living history
Comments: